Why Use a Motor Degreaser?

Okay, so why should you even bother with a motor degreaser? Great question! Think of your engine as the heart of your vehicle. Over time, it gets covered in all sorts of gunk – oil, grease, dirt, and other nasty stuff. This build-up can cause a bunch of problems. First off, it insulates the engine, which means it can't cool down as efficiently. Overheating? No, thank you! Plus, a dirty engine can lead to corrosion and wear and tear on important parts. Nobody wants that. Using a quality motor degreaser regularly helps remove all that grime, allowing your engine to breathe and stay cool. A clean engine is a happy engine, and a happy engine means a happy driver! So, regular degreasing not only keeps things looking good but also ensures your vehicle runs at its best for years to come. Trust me; your future self will thank you for it. Keeping your engine clean helps prevent costly repairs down the road. It’s a simple step that makes a huge difference. It also makes it easier to spot potential problems early on. When everything is covered in grease, it’s hard to see if there’s a leak or a crack. A clean engine lets you catch these issues before they turn into major headaches. So, degreasing isn’t just about looks; it’s about maintenance and peace of mind.

Types of Motor Degreasers

Alright, let's talk about the different types of motor degreasers out there. You've got a few main categories to choose from, each with its own pros and cons. Understanding these differences will help you pick the right one for your specific needs. First up, we have solvent-based degreasers. These are the heavy-hitters, designed to dissolve tough grease and grime quickly. They're super effective, but they can also be a bit harsh. Make sure you're using them in a well-ventilated area and following the instructions carefully. Next, there are water-based degreasers. These are generally safer and more environmentally friendly. They might not be as potent as the solvent-based ones, but they're still great for regular cleaning and maintenance. You'll also find aerosol degreasers, which are convenient for spot cleaning and hard-to-reach areas. Just spray them on, let them sit for a bit, and wipe away the grime. Lastly, there are foaming degreasers, which cling to surfaces for better cleaning action. They're great for vertical surfaces and areas where you want the degreaser to stay put. Each type has its strengths, so consider the type of cleaning you need to do and choose accordingly. Always remember to read the labels and follow the safety precautions to keep yourself and your engine safe.

How to Use a Motor Degreaser

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ty: how to actually use a motor degreaser. Don't worry, it's not rocket science! First things first, safety first! Wear gloves and eye protection to protect yourself from any potential splashes or fumes. Next, make sure your engine is cool before you start. You don't want to spray degreaser on a hot engine – that's a recipe for disaster. Once your engine is cool, cover any sensitive components, like electrical connections, with plastic bags or tape. This will prevent the degreaser from damaging them. Now, it's time to apply the degreaser. Follow the instructions on the product label. Generally, you'll want to spray the degreaser liberally on the greasy areas, making sure to coat everything evenly. Let the degreaser soak for the recommended amount of time. This gives it a chance to break down the grime. After soaking, use a brush or a cloth to scrub any stubborn areas. Pay attention to those hard-to-reach spots. Finally, rinse everything off with water. A garden hose works great for this. Make sure you get all the degreaser off, as any residue can attract more dirt. Once you're done rinsing, let your engine dry completely before starting it up. And that's it! A clean, happy engine is now yours to enjoy. Regular degreasing will keep it running smoothly and looking great for years to come. Remember to always follow the product instructions and take safety precautions to ensure a successful and safe cleaning process.

Tips for Maintaining a Clean Engine

Maintaining a clean engine isn't just a one-time thing; it's an ongoing process. Here are some tips to help you keep your engine in tip-top shape. First, regular cleaning is key. Don't wait until your engine is covered in layers of grime. Aim to degrease it every few months, or more often if you drive in dirty or dusty conditions. This prevents build-up and makes cleaning easier. Next, use quality products. Don't skimp on cheap degreasers that might not be effective or could damage your engine. Invest in a good quality degreaser that's designed for automotive use. Another important tip is to address leaks promptly. Oil and fluid leaks can attract dirt and grime, making your engine even dirtier. Fix any leaks as soon as you notice them to prevent further build-up. Also, protect your engine from the elements. Parking in a garage or under a carport can help shield your engine from dirt, dust, and other contaminants. If you can't park indoors, consider using an engine cover. Finally, inspect your engine regularly. Keep an eye out for any signs of dirt, grime, or leaks. The sooner you catch these problems, the easier they will be to fix. By following these tips, you can keep your engine clean, running smoothly, and looking great for years to come. Remember, a clean engine is a happy engine, and a happy engine means a happy ride!
